be honest (now that it has been more than 10 years) was not all that familiar with it. 03/25/05 @ 08:59 · Email: dave_rod@juno.com · IP: 151.148.194.72 Comment from: Dave Rod [Visitor] Barry, Before the 1973 Dodge sports van, there was a 1949 Ford pickup truck that served as the general camp utility vehicle. The story I heard was that Ewalu inherited it from Brown's grocery in Strawberry Point; it used to be their delivery truck. It was a great vehicle to learn to drive "straight stick" on because the clutch was so very forgiving. We used it to haul stuff out to the campsites from the Cedar Lodge area and also for the occasional trip into Strawberry Point. (It couldn't go much farther than that.)
